Key Takeaways

  • Prioritize formulas containing BHA or salicylic acid if your primary concern is active breakouts and clogged pores.
  • Look for soothing botanical extracts like heartleaf or centella to calm redness before it turns into a persistent blemish.
  • Choose alcohol-free compositions to ensure you are not dehydrating your skin while you attempt to control excess oil.
  • Verify the presence of non-comedogenic ingredients to ensure the toner will not cause secondary congestion.
  • Select products with niacinamide if you want to tackle both oil production and the appearance of post-acne marks simultaneously.

  1. Dermagency Zeroca 86 Toner

    This toner acts like a calm reset button for inflamed pores. It is your best choice if you struggle with persistent redness and excess oil. The formula is remarkably lightweight, sinking into the skin without leaving a sticky residue.

    You will appreciate how it balances oil production while keeping sensitivity in check. It avoids heavy fragrances that often trigger breakouts. Keep in mind that those with extremely dry skin might find this a bit too drying for daily use.

  2. Some By Mi Miracle Toner

    If your skin feels rough or congested, this toner serves as a chemical broom. It uses a trio of acids to sweep away dead skin cells that usually lead to clogged pores. The addition of niacinamide helps brighten your complexion while you clear active spots.

    Most people find the immediate cooling effect refreshing during a breakout. Be careful, however, as the high acid content can be intense if you have a compromised moisture barrier. Use it gradually to see how your skin reacts.
